Xometry (NASDAQ: XMTR) powers the industries of today and tomorrow by connecting the people with big ideas to the manufacturers who can bring them to life. Xometry's digital marketplace gives manufacturers the critical resources they need to grow their business while also making it easy for buyers at Fortune 1000 companies to tap into global manufacturing capacity.
Xometry is seeking a Principal Software Engineer to lead the technical design and engineering of systems to predict and remediate challenges in manufacturing customers' parts. This team's solutions combine ML model predictions, part geometry information, and customer information to help us accurately predict manufacturing cost and find the partners to manufacture parts successfully. This role does not require previous knowledge of manufacturing or ML, though it is helpful.
